The Czech Republic has an annual birth rate of 8.4 births per 1,000 people, compared to 30 for Guinea-Bissau. The average number of children a woman is expected to have during her lifetime — the fertility rate, is 1.45 in the Czech Republic and 3.84 in Guinea-Bissau — 164.6% difference.
1960 vs 2023, the fertility rate has decreased by 30.6% in the Czech Republic and by 35.2% in Guinea-Bissau — in 1960, it was 2.09 and 5.92, respectively.
- The Czech Republic is ranked 170/196 by birth rate compared to 32/196 for Guinea-Bissau.
- The mean age at childbearing (for all the births, not just the first) is 30.6 in the Czech Republic — it's 29.4 in Guinea-Bissau.
- Annual births per 1,000 women ages 15-19 (adolescent birth rate or teenage mother rate) is 5.98 in the Czech Republic vs 82 in Guinea-Bissau.
- In the Czech Republic, 21.5% of the population is composed of women of reproductive age (15-49), compared to 25.5% in Guinea-Bissau.

According to the latest available data on birth rates, the fertility rate in the Czech Republic was 1.45 children per woman in 2023, compared to 3.84 in Guinea-Bissau in 2023. The replacement level is considered to be 2.1 children per woman.

The chart above illustrates the comparison of the absolute yearly changes in population resulting from births and deaths.
Excluding migration, the natural population change due to births and deaths from 2022 to 2023 was -0.2% in the Czech Republic and +2.3% in Guinea-Bissau.
For the past 10 years, the annual natural population change has been -0.07% in the Czech Republic and +2.44% in Guinea-Bissau.

The maternal mortality rate, which is the probability of dying during childbirth or within 42 days of pregnancy termination, is 3 deaths per 100,000 live births in the Czech Republic, compared to 505 deaths in Guinea-Bissau.
